Response to the following problem:

Three wealthy friends, Tom, Grant, and Karen, each decided to donate $5,000,000 to the not-for-profit organization of their choice. Each donation was made on May 21, 2011.

Prepare the entries required for each of the recipient organizations under the following scenarios.

1. Tom chose to contribute to a local voluntary health and welfare organization, and no restrictions were placed on the use of the donated resources.

a. Prepare the May 21, 2011, entry.

b. Prepare any entries necessary in 2012 if $2,300,000 of the gift is used to finance operating expenses.

2. Grant contributed to a local private university, and the donation was restricted to research.

a. Prepare the May 21, 2011, entry.

b. Prepare any entries necessary in 2012 if $2,300,000 of the gift is used to finance research expenses.

3. Karen gave to the local hospital, and the donation was restricted for construction of a fixed asset.

a. Prepare the May 21, 2011, entry.

b. Prepare any entries necessary in 2012 if $2,300,000 of the gift is used to finance construction costs.
